Transaction 31f5110068273de1d87fcf75c4828e4e1c063c206f586fb01e14e364df32414d
1 Input
1 Output
-
31f5110068273de1d87fcf75c4828e4e1c063c206f586fb01e14e364df32414d:0
- value
- 87108907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 149738f700956df4eb72c09b3f243f3d469e7b14 OP_EQUAL
- address
- 33ZtbWFgdgv1Umxua2KDBXseGD6YV1ocuJ